Scan Business Cards to Add Contacts
1 On the Contacts screen, go to > Scan or go to Business cards > Scan.
2 Place a business card on a at surface, adjust the camera so that the contents on the
business card are clearly displayed in the viewnder, then touch to capture a single or
multiple business cards in a row.
3 After the photos are taken, your device will automatically identify the contact information.
Touch to save the contact.
You can view the scanned business cards in Business cards.
Scan a QR Code to Add a Contact
If a QR code contains contact information, you can scan the QR code to quickly add a
contact.
1 On the Contacts screen, go to
> Scan or go to Business cards > Scan.
2 Take a photo of a QR code or select a photo of a QR code from Gallery, and contact
information contained in the QR code can be identied and added.
Search for Contacts
1 From the Contacts screen, go to > Settings > Display preferences and touch All
contacts to display all your contacts.
2 Search for contacts using either of the following methods:
• Swipe down from the middle of the home screen and enter a keyword for the contact
you want to
nd in the search box (such as their name, initials, or email address).
You can also enter multiple keywords, such as "John London", to quickly nd matching
contacts.
• Enter keywords for the contact you want to nd in the search box above the contacts
list. Matching results will be displayed below the search box.
Share Contacts
1 On the Contacts screen, select the contact you want to share, then go to
> Share
contact.
2 Select a sharing method, then follow the onscreen instructions to share the contact.
Export Contacts
1 On the Contacts screen, go to > Settings > Import/Export.
2 Touch Export to storage and follow the onscreen instructions to export contacts.
The exported .vcf les are saved in the root directory of your device's internal storage by
default. You can open Files to view the exported les in the internal storage.
